Are chickpea pasta healthy?

Firstly, let's delve into the nutritional profile of chickpea pasta. One serving of chickpea pasta typically contains around 190 calories, 35 grams of carbohydrates, 7 grams of fiber, and 11 grams of protein. Compared to traditional wheat pasta, chickpea pasta has fewer carbohydrates and more protein, making it a suitable option for individuals following low-carb or high-protein diets. Additionally, the fiber content in chickpea pasta promotes better digestion and can help regulate blood sugar levels, making it a favorable choice for those with diabetes or those looking to manage their weight.

One of the significant health benefits of chickpea pasta lies in its protein content. Chickpeas, the primary ingredient in this pasta, are an excellent source of plant-based protein. Protein plays a crucial role in tissue repair, muscle development, and overall growth and maintenance of the body. A diet rich in protein can help boost metabolism, increase satiety, and support weight management. For vegetarians and vegans, chickpea pasta offers a valuable protein source that can easily be incorporated into their diets.

Fiber, another essential component of chickpea pasta, brings a multitude of health benefits. Most individuals do not consume enough fiber in their diets, leading to issues like constipation, digestive disorders, and increased risk of chronic diseases. With approximately 7 grams of fiber per serving, chickpea pasta provides a significant amount of fiber that aids in maintaining a healthy digestive system. The high fiber content also contributes to a feeling of fullness, preventing overeating and aiding in weight management.

In addition to being gluten-free, chickpea pasta has a low glycemic index (GI). The GI measures how quickly a particular food raises blood sugar levels. Foods with a high GI can cause a rapid spike in blood sugar, leading to energy crashes and difficulty managing diabetes. Chickpea pasta, with its low GI, produces a slower, steadier rise in blood sugar levels, providing sustained energy and promoting stable blood sugar control.

Furthermore, chickpea pasta contains essential minerals and vitamins. Chickpea flour is an excellent source of iron, magnesium, zinc, and B vitamins. Iron is vital for the production of red blood cells and oxygen transport, while magnesium and zinc support various enzymatic processes in the body. B vitamins play a crucial role in metabolism, brain function, and maintaining healthy skin and hair.

It is important to note that chickpea pasta may not be suitable for everyone. While it is a healthy option for most individuals, those with a known chickpea allergy should avoid consuming it. Additionally, some people may experience digestive discomfort or bloating due to the high fiber content. It is always best to listen to your body and make adjustments accordingly.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Are chickpea pasta a healthier alternative to traditional pasta?

Yes, chickpea pasta is generally considered to be a healthier alternative to traditional pasta. It is made from chickpea flour, which provides more protein and fiber compared to regular wheat pasta. Additionally, chickpea pasta is usually gluten-free, making it suitable for those with gluten sensitivities or allergies.

2. What are the nutritional benefits of chickpea pasta?

Chickpea pasta is rich in protein, fiber, and essential minerals such as iron and magnesium. It also contains fewer carbohydrates and calories compared to regular pasta, making it a nutritious option for those looking to manage their weight or maintain a balanced diet.

3. Can chickpea pasta help in weight loss?

Chickpea pasta can be a helpful addition to a weight loss diet. Its high protein and fiber content can promote satiety, keeping you feeling fuller for longer. This can help reduce overall calorie intake and support weight loss goals.

4. Does chickpea pasta have any potential side effects?

While chickpea pasta is generally safe for consumption, some individuals may experience digestive discomfort, such as bloating or gas, due to the high fiber content. It is recommended to start with small portions and gradually increase intake to allow the body to adjust.

5. How can chickpea pasta be incorporated into a balanced diet?

Chickpea pasta can be used as a substitute for regular pasta in a variety of dishes, such as pasta salads, stir-fries, and soups. It can be paired with v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y sauces to create a nutritious and well-balanced meal. However, it is still important to maintain a diverse diet and include other nutrient-rich food groups for overall health.
